Discover the latest concept from Taco Bell - Live Más Café, offering a unique experience with specialty drinks and traditional menu items. Learn about the innovation and growth in Taco Bell's beverage lineup.

Live Más Café by Taco Bell introduces a unique concept where customers can enjoy a range of specialty drinks alongside the traditional menu. The café not only prioritizes exceptional flavor but also focuses on creating a welcoming atmosphere for guests to savor their beverages. By incorporating Chillers, Agua Refrescas, coffees, and more, Taco Bell has aimed to redefine the beverage experience for its loyal customers.
With a strong emphasis on beverages, Taco Bell has incorporated a variety of new drink options to cater to evolving consumer preferences. From Coffee Chillers to Churro Chillers, and the introduction of innovative choices like Limonada Freeze and Agua Refrescas, Taco Bell's commitment to beverage innovation is evident. The company's dedication to making beverages as iconic as its food showcases a strategic shift towards enhancing the overall customer experience.

The collaboration between Taco Bell and Diversified Restaurant Group has been instrumental in the success of Live Más Café. In an evolving market where specialty beverages are gaining significant traction, Taco Bell's Live Más Café has the potential to make a lasting impact. With key players like McDonald's entering the beverage arena and the rapid growth of various concepts nationwide, Live Más Café positions Taco Bell as a frontrunner in the beverage innovation space. By increasing incremental sales and capturing the attention of beverage-seeking consumers, Taco Bell solidifies its position as an industry leader focused on redefining the future of beverages in the fast-food sector.
Products like the Churro Chillers not only serve as additional offerings but also drive incremental sales and create special moments for customers. By encouraging extra visits and catering to varying consumer preferences, Live Más Café enhances customer engagement and fosters a sense of uniqueness in every interaction. The café's operating hours from 7 a.m. to 3 a.m. cater to diverse schedules, ensuring that fans can enjoy their favorite beverages at their convenience, further strengthening the bond between Taco Bell and its loyal customers.
